Marshy Swamp
Marshy Swamp is a stream in Westmoreland County, Eastern Virginia, Virginia. Marshy Swamp is situated nearby to the hamlet Indian Field, as well as near Cobham Park.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Warsaw
Town
Photo: Ser Amantio di Nicolao,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Warsaw is an incorporated town in and the county seat of Richmond County, Virginia, United States. The population was 1,637 at the 2020 census and is estimated to be 2,330 as of 2023. Warsaw is situated 2 miles west of Marshy Swamp.
